dc.description.abstractTechnology adoption is being talked of more frequently now as compared to tenĀ­ fifteen years back. It is because today the major thrust of organization's competitiveness is in their ability to employ new technology in their day-to-day tasks. This study was carried out to investigate if sensemaking activities influence technology acc ptance model (TAM) and if the strength of relationship between TAM's constructs changes over a period of time. This study was a panel-based longitudinal study, whereby data were collected in three stages in one semester.en_US
